Heritage Green Nursing Home is a charitable organization based in Stoney Creek, Ontario, classified by the CRA under organizations relieving poverty. It appears on the charity register the way hospitals, universities, and other publicly funded bodies do — to issue tax receipts — rather than as a donation-driven charity in the usual sense. In its fiscal year ending December 31, 2024, it reported $19M in revenue and $18.8M in expenditures.

Its funding that year was roughly 78% from government. Government funding is the majority of its budget. In 2024, 1 other registered charity reported granting it a combined $8,000.

Its highest-paid positions fell in the $120,000–159,999 range (8 positions in that band). The charity reported 313 permanent full-time positions.

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 11 names.
